PASCO COUNTY, FL — The Florida Department of Health in Pasco County is offering free rapid HIV and hepatitis C testing on Wednesdays and Thursdays beginning immediately at 10841 Little Road in New Port Richey.
Testing is available by appointment only. Call 727-619-0260 to schedule an appointment.
In the U.S., for every seven people who have HIV, one person does not know it. Testing is the only way to know if you have HIV.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ention recommends everyone between the ages of 13 and 64 get tested for HIV at least once; however, anyone at higher risk for getting HIV should get tested at least once a year.
